Abstract

The determination of ethyl 6,7-di-isobutoxy-4-hydroxyquinoline-3-carboxylate (buquinolate) in animal feeding stuff is described. A modified Zeisel treatment is carried out on a direct extract of the feeding stuff and the liberated halide is determined by gas chromatography, with an electroncapture detector. Time-consuming separation techniques are unnecessary and buquinolate can be determined in the presence of other additives closely related in structure.
